Schedule - Tenth Free Spirit Film Festival

Free Spirit Film Festival 2014

25 to 29 October 5 pm - Tibetan Day School, Dolma Chowk, McLeod Ganj

Films screened every night from 5 pm
Ticket: Rs 200, available at gate.

Saturday 25 October

Plundering Tibet [India Premiere]
A personal take on mining in Tibet

Directed by Michael Buckley Tibet/Canada 2014 | Documentary | 24m | English summary
